Hi folks,
Knowing that we can use command #bpimagelist to preview backup images so
that u know which tape needed for recovery. Just wondering whether NBU 5.0
Windows server allows a preview of all backup policies without actually
starting them, knowing that Legato NetWorker can do it by #savegrp -pvvvvv
<group_name>
